About The Position

This role is categorized as onsite, requiring the successful candidate to report to Lansing, MI on a full-time basis. The Director will lead a team of HR/LR Professionals across multiple vehicle manufacturing sites in the Lansing Region. Key responsibilities include managing workload, balancing priorities, and ensuring deliverables meet quality standards in compliance with laws, collective agreements, and policies. The role also involves championing HR/LR projects, partnering with People Leaders to foster GM culture, enhance employee experiences, and improve engagement/inclusion. Strategic administration of collective agreements, collaborative problem-solving, and providing development to the HR/LR team are crucial. The Director will participate in HRM and Talent Forum discussions, ensure appropriate administration of local policies and legislation, and provide regional communications on HR/LR initiatives. The position supports the implementation of Human Capital Plans, enterprise initiatives like Talent Spotting and Compensation Programs, and manages the employee lifecycle from hire to exit. It also involves providing guidance on daily issues, acting as an escalation point for complex HR/LR matters, and partnering with stakeholders and legal departments to manage employment requirements, reduce legal risks, and ensure regulatory compliance.
